Features

  • Easy to Use: This accessory features a 3/8-inch QC connection, providing a universal fit that is easy to hook up to high pressure washer hoses.
  • More Jets, More Clean, Less Time: With 10x more coverage than a standard nozzle, this surface cleaner has two high-pressure, rotating jets which provide quick, streak-free cleaning and allows you to complete your pressure washing projects more quickly
  • High Quality Design: The powder-coated steel shroud and stainless steel nozzles provide protection against corrosion; brass components and in-line filter provide durability; Shroud helps to prevent overspray, keeping the user and surrounding area dryer
  • Great for Industrial and Commercial Projects: The 20-inch diameter makes cleaning large surfaces such as driveways, patios, decks, sidewalks and more quick and easy. The lightweight ergonomic handle decreases operator fatigue.
  • Compatibility and Power: This surface scrubber works with most gas-powered pressure washers with a minimum recommended rating of 3450PSI and 2.3GPM and pressure washer machines up to a maximum of 4500PSI and 3.8GPM. Max temp 212F

Description

The SIMPSON pressure washer surface cleaner is used for cleaning driveways, patios, decks, sidewalks and more. Its 20″ diameter provides 10X more coverage to clean more efficiently for big jobs. For hot or cold water pressure washers with ratings between a recommended minimum 3450 PSI and maximum 4500 PSI, the 80182 surface cleaner has two high-pressure, rotating jets to help remove dirt and grime from surfaces with 10X more coverage than a standard nozzle. The powder-coated steel shroud and stainless steel nozzles provide protection against corrosion; the brass components and in-line filter provide durability. The powder-coated steel shroud prevents overspray, allowing the user and surrounding areas to stay dryer when compared to a pressure washing wand.

  • It's temperamental, but works!
Size: 15 Inch
I read numerous reviews before purchasing. All of these devices no matter what brand all have negative reviews regarding not spinning properly so I weighed all other factors and purchased the Simpson. The first time I used it was on a wooden bridge deck and it worked great. It took far less time than using a wand. The next morning I decided to do my deck. That's when the trouble began. The device did not spin properly and put circular groves all over the deck. After tinkering with it (lubricating, blowing it out with an air compressor) I was able to get it spinning properly. I also changed the o-ring inside to one that fit a little tighter. Since then I have done 3 driveways and it has worked very well. At first it, spins slowly, but by pulling the wand trigger on and off a few times it spins great and works normally from then on. It's a tremendous time saver. I strongly recommend extreme caution if you are going to use it on wood. As I mentioned, it usually does not spin properly at first, so if you have it on a wood deck it will leave grove marks. I used mine with a 3100 psi Dewalt power washer. My neighbor tried using it with a 2500 psi power washer and it would not spin properly. Bottom line: It's temperamental, but worth it given the amount of time it saves. ... show more
